Very nice, atmosphere, upscale and classy.
Our server did a good job of suggestive selling by asking right off if we’d like to start off with a cappuccino, which sounded good so we got it.
We ordered juice, which was fresh-squeezed and quite good. I don’t think I’ve ever had fresh-squeezed grapefruit juice at a restaurant before.
I had a carrot muffin, which was delicious. I also had the Crab and Avocado Omelette, which was also delicious. I had a side order of corned beef hash which had good flavor; I liked it, even though the corned beef was ground finer than I prefer.
Johann had the Mixed Berry Pain Perdu (stuffed French toast). He enjoyed it very much; I tasted it and thought it was great. He got some good sausage with that.
This is a place I recommend for breakfast. It’s not a unique, local place, but it’s a very good breakfast experience.
Our total this week for two: $28.90. It’s not cheap, but it’s a good value.
